新聞中心
Redis是近年來(lái)流行的分布式緩存服務(wù),它提供快速和可靠的高性能數(shù)據(jù)存儲(chǔ)服務(wù),可以加快企業(yè)應(yīng)用程序的數(shù)據(jù)訪問(wèn)和讀寫(xiě)性能以及減少數(shù)據(jù)庫(kù)壓力。

為了評(píng)估Redis的性能,云部落采用JMeter對(duì)Redis的連接性能進(jìn)行測(cè)試,以下是具體的實(shí)踐內(nèi)容:
使用JMeter進(jìn)行基礎(chǔ)性能測(cè)試,測(cè)試Redis服務(wù)器的連接數(shù)和吞吐量。首先下載并安裝JMeter,然后使用Apache Common Pool庫(kù)新建一個(gè)Redis泳道,添加ThreadGroup,并通過(guò)JMeter拓?fù)浣Y(jié)構(gòu),建立與Redis服務(wù)器的連接,設(shè)置Redis連接池大小,和每個(gè)線程請(qǐng)求Redis服務(wù)器的次數(shù)。
然后,使用JMeter模擬器,完成測(cè)試。在采樣器欄中,添加一個(gè)參數(shù)化測(cè)試,如下代碼:
“`java
SampleResult.sampleStart();
Jedis jedis = null;
try{
jedis = (Jedis) pool.getResource();
jedis.auth(“#Password#”); // Redis設(shè)置口令
jedis.set(“#key#”, “#value#”);//測(cè)試代碼
} catch (Exception e) {
e.printStackTrace();
}finally {
if (jedis != null) {
pool.returnResource(jedis);
}
SampleResult.sampleEnd();
}
啟動(dòng)JMeter,設(shè)置線程數(shù)量和持續(xù)時(shí)間,生成測(cè)試報(bào)告,評(píng)估Redis連接性能數(shù)據(jù)。通過(guò)JMeter我們可以模擬并發(fā)客戶端連接Redis服務(wù)器,以獲得更準(zhǔn)確的測(cè)試結(jié)果。
通過(guò)上述測(cè)試,我們對(duì)Redis連接性能都有了更深入的了解,可以根據(jù)不同場(chǎng)景設(shè)置不同的Redis連接池大小,更好地提高Redis服務(wù)器的性能。
成都網(wǎng)站設(shè)計(jì)制作選創(chuàng)新互聯(lián),專(zhuān)業(yè)網(wǎng)站建設(shè)公司。
成都創(chuàng)新互聯(lián)10余年專(zhuān)注成都高端網(wǎng)站建設(shè)定制開(kāi)發(fā)服務(wù),為客戶提供專(zhuān)業(yè)的成都網(wǎng)站制作,成都網(wǎng)頁(yè)設(shè)計(jì),成都網(wǎng)站設(shè)計(jì)服務(wù);成都創(chuàng)新互聯(lián)服務(wù)內(nèi)容包含成都網(wǎng)站建設(shè),小程序開(kāi)發(fā),營(yíng)銷(xiāo)網(wǎng)站建設(shè),網(wǎng)站改版,服務(wù)器托管租用等互聯(lián)網(wǎng)服務(wù)。
網(wǎng)頁(yè)名稱:研究Redis連接性能的測(cè)試實(shí)踐(redis連接數(shù)測(cè)試)
轉(zhuǎn)載來(lái)于:http://www.dlmjj.cn/article/dhipihi.html


咨詢
建站咨詢
